Product reviews:
New Balance Access Park Bellville are new balance store access park kenilworth
new balance store access park kenilworth
Sam
2025-12-23 iphone XS Max
A16 - NEW BALANCE - 021 903 5128 Great new balance store access park kenilworth
new balance store access park kenilworth
Sampson
2025-12-22 iphone 11 Pro
Access Park Bellville new balance store access park kenilworth
new balance store access park kenilworth